Turkish Court Clears Troops to Afghanistan - 2001-11-22


Turkey's highest court has cleared the way for the government to send troops to Afghanistan.

The Constitutional Court in Ankara rejected a suit by more than 100 opposition lawmakers to block the deployment, which they say is unconstitutional.

The court voted seven-to-four to uphold parliament's decision in October to give the government full authority to send troops abroad.

Turkey announced November first it would send up to 90 special forces troops to Afghanistan to fight terrorism, help distribute aid and train anti-Taleban forces as part of the U-S-led operation dubbed "Enduring Freedom."
